Skeletal Muscle Mitochondrial Dysfunction Mediated by <i>Pseudomonas aeruginosa</i> Quorum Sensing Transcription Factor MvfR: Reversing Effects with Anti-MvfR and Mitochondrial-Targeted Compounds
2024-05-05
Abstract excerpt
<h4>ABSTRACT</h4> Sepsis and chronic infections with Pseudomonas aeruginosa, a leading “ESKAPE” bacterial pathogen, are associated with increased morbidity and mortality and skeletal muscle atrophy. The actions of this pathogen on skeletal muscle remain poorly understood. In skeletal muscle, mitochondria serve as a crucial energy source, which may be perturbed by infection.
